diff options
| author | Ryan Scott <ryan.gl.scott@gmail.com> | 2020-01-06 18:02:21 -0500 | 
|---|---|---|
| committer | Ryan Scott <ryan.gl.scott@gmail.com> | 2020-01-08 07:41:13 -0500 | 
| commit | e2c0a757f5aae215d89e464a7e45f9777c27c8f0 (patch) | |
| tree | 86f1ee7ca6517bc2821ea5151768a8661cd352ef | |
| parent | c67c24fc90e8217c3d2139e99e92889e1df180f8 (diff) | |
Changes for GHC#17608
See https://gitlab.haskell.org/ghc/ghc/merge_requests/2372
| -rw-r--r-- | haddock-api/src/Haddock/Interface/Create.hs | 7 | 
1 files changed, 4 insertions, 3 deletions
diff --git a/haddock-api/src/Haddock/Interface/Create.hs b/haddock-api/src/Haddock/Interface/Create.hs index 985bffea..73857a90 100644 --- a/haddock-api/src/Haddock/Interface/Create.hs +++ b/haddock-api/src/Haddock/Interface/Create.hs @@ -540,9 +540,10 @@ topDecls =  -- | Extract a map of fixity declarations only  mkFixMap :: HsGroup GhcRn -> FixMap -mkFixMap group_ = M.fromList [ (n,f) -                             | L _ (FixitySig _ ns f) <- hs_fixds group_, -                               L _ n <- ns ] +mkFixMap group_ = +  M.fromList [ (n,f) +             | L _ (FixitySig _ ns f) <- hsGroupTopLevelFixitySigs group_, +               L _ n <- ns ]  -- | Take all declarations except pragmas, infix decls, rules from an 'HsGroup'.  | 
